Turkish law enforcement conducted widespread raids targeting LGBTQ+ organizations and HIV support services in Istanbul during early Sunday operations. Authorities detained multiple activists and members while simultaneously storming association headquarters and frequented community spaces. This enforcement action reflects escalating tensions between the Turkish government and LGBTQ+ advocacy groups, raising concerns among human rights organizations regarding freedom of assembly and civil liberties protection in the country.
